在机械加工领域,编程技巧的掌握对于提升加工效率至关重要。轮廓精加工编程,作为现代数控机床操作中的一个重要环节,对于提高加工精度和效率有着显著的作用。本文将详细介绍轮廓精加工编程的技巧,帮助您轻松提升机械加工效率。
一、轮廓精加工编程概述
轮廓精加工编程是指在数控机床上对工件进行轮廓加工的编程过程。它主要包括轮廓的生成、路径的规划、刀具路径的生成以及代码的编写等环节。通过精确的编程,可以使机械加工更加高效、精准。
二、轮廓精加工编程技巧
1. 熟练掌握CAD/CAM软件
CAD/CAM软件是进行轮廓精加工编程的重要工具。熟练掌握CAD/CAM软件,可以快速生成高质量的加工轮廓,提高编程效率。以下是一些常用的CAD/CAM软件:
- AutoCAD
- SolidWorks
- Mastercam
- Cimatron
- UG
2. 合理选择刀具和切削参数
刀具和切削参数的选择对加工效率和质量有着直接影响。以下是一些选择刀具和切削参数的技巧:
- 根据工件材料、形状和加工要求选择合适的刀具;
- 优化切削参数,如切削速度、进给量和切削深度,以提高加工效率;
- 注意刀具的磨损情况,及时更换刀具,以保证加工质量。
3. 优化加工路径
加工路径的优化是提高加工效率的关键。以下是一些优化加工路径的技巧:
- 采用顺铣、逆铣等合适的加工方式;
- 避免不必要的刀具移动,减少空行程;
- 优化刀具路径,减少加工过程中的振动和切削力。
4. 编写高效的加工程序
编写高效的加工程序对于提高加工效率至关重要。以下是一些编写加工程序的技巧:
- 使用简短的代码,避免冗余指令;
- 优化循环语句,提高代码执行效率;
- 合理安排程序结构,便于调试和维护。
5. 培养良好的编程习惯
良好的编程习惯可以提高编程效率,降低出错率。以下是一些培养良好编程习惯的技巧:
- 遵循编程规范,提高代码可读性;
- 定期检查和修改程序,确保程序的正确性;
- 与团队成员保持良好的沟通,共同提高编程水平。
三、案例分析
以下是一个简单的轮廓精加工编程案例,帮助您更好地理解编程技巧:
案例背景
某企业需要加工一个凸轮零件,材料为45号钢,尺寸要求较高。要求在数控车床上进行轮廓精加工。
编程步骤
- 使用CAD软件绘制凸轮零件的轮廓图;
- 将CAD模型导入CAM软件,生成刀具路径;
- 根据加工要求选择合适的刀具和切削参数;
- 编写加工程序,包括主程序和子程序;
- 检查程序,确保无误;
- 在数控车床上进行加工。
通过以上步骤,可以高效、精准地完成凸轮零件的轮廓精加工。
四、总结
掌握轮廓精加工编程技巧,有助于提高机械加工效率。在实际操作中,应根据工件材料、形状和加工要求,灵活运用编程技巧,不断提高编程水平。希望本文对您有所帮助。
